Leaking uPVC

Over time, UPVC windows can develop several issues that include leaks. These can result from damaged or worn sealant cracking frames, steamed up double glazing. Leaking uPVC can cause drafts, increased energy bills, and lower indoor comfort. Fortunately, these problems can be corrected without replacing the entire window.

First, check the seals and frame for cracks or gaps that are visible. If you find any, you can use an UPVC-compatible sealant to fix the damage. You'll need to clean and eliminate any dirt, debris or other contaminants that might impede the seal.

If you have windows that are double-glazed, it is important to keep them properly sealed. This will stop cold air from seeping into your home in the winter, and hot air from leaving in the summer, and it can save you money on your energy bills. A professional glazier can repair double-glazed windows to avoid condensation and air leakage. They will also examine the sash alignment and hardware to make sure that they function correctly.

Hinges

Window-Repairs.-150x150.jpgHinges are mechanical bearings that connect two objects and restrict their rotation to one plane or the axis. They are used for doors, windows containers, enclosures, furniture, and other applications. There are a variety of hinges, and each has a specific purpose and capacity for load. Understanding how hinges function is essential for making an informed decision.

The mortise hinge is the most commonly used type of hinge for doors. This hinge is comprised of two leaves that are held together by a pin made of steel. This hinge is commonly used for commercial and residential doors and is available in a variety of styles and finishes. The door's design and frame as well as the available space will determine the hinge you select.

You may want to consider an extra robust hinge depending on the weight and size of your doors. These hinges are made to withstand heavy loads and are typically made out of stainless-steel or cast iron. They are more expensive than other types of hinges, but they are also stronger and last longer.
